Roles

Superna's role-based access control provides security and flexibility for your team. By assigning specific roles to users, you can control exactly what actions they can perform within the platform, maintaining both security and appropriate access levels for different team members.

Available Roles

RolePurposeCapabilities
AdminFull platform control• Read data
• Write data
• Change settings
• Manage users
ViewerRead-only access• Read data
• Cannot write data
• Cannot change settings
• Cannot manage users

important

Admins cannot change their own role to prevent accidentally removing all admin access to the system.
